Abstract

Techniques for post-rendering image transformation including outputting an image frame including a plurality of first pixels by sequentially generating and outputting multiple color component fields including a first color component field and a second color component field by applying one or more two-dimensional (2D) image transformations to at least one portion of the plurality of source pixels by first, second, and third image transformation pipelines, to generate transformed pixel color data for the first color component field and the second color component field.
